Would anyone in this forum find it useful to be able to type a message in Teams (either 1:1 chat or a team thread), hit enter, and have that message not sent until the recipient's status is available? Ideally, this would be an option for which we could set a default (either on or off) and then toggle it for an individual message with a keyboard shortcut depending upon the message's urgency. Hopefully, it would be handled at the cloud level (not the local level like in Outlook) so that it is not dependent on the sender's computer being awake when the recipient's status becomes available. There is an idea posted for this in a UserVoice forum, but it does not have many votes yet. https://microsoftteams.uservoice.com/forums/555103-public/suggestions/18874141-time-delay-post In my own organization, the people I most frequently need to ping spend much time in meetings or on client calls that I would rather not interrupt, but it hinders my productivity too much to keep checking on when they will be available. If I send a message during their meeting anyway, there is too great a chance they will miss it. I don't know when this happened but search has changed in teams recently, and it's unbelievably useless. Searching within a single conversation isn't intuitive. Took me forever to figure out how that works. But the biggest problem is that now when I search it returns results and in the past when I'd click the item in the results list, it would take me to that point in time of the entire conversation. Now it just shows me the single message and I can't see the entire conversation surrounding it. Since the conversation was back in July, and this is a person I talk to all day every day scrolling back to that point in time would take a VERY long time. Basically we're encountering an issue in our development environment that happened previously and I fixed it back in July but it's happening again and I don't remember what we did to fix it. So I search for the term I need, get the messages around that time in July, and I see just that one message but I need to see the entire conversation. This is a terrible change that wasn't thought through.
